#E7DDDB Hex color

#E7DDDB

The hexadecimal color code #E7DDDB corresponds to the code RGB( 231, 221, 219 ). It's a shade of Red. This color is a combination of red (at 0,91 level), green (at 0,87 level) and blue (at 0,86 level). Its brightness is 88% and its saturation is 20%. It is composed of red at 34%, green at 32% and blue at 32%.
